📜  postgresql 数组最后一个元素 - SQL (1)

📅  最后修改于: 2023-12-03 15:18:39.248000             🧑  作者: Mango

PostgreSQL 数组最后一个元素 - SQL

在 PostgreSQL 中,可以通过使用下标来访问数组元素,这使得查找数组最后一个元素变得非常容易。

SELECT array[array_length(your_array, 1)] AS last_element FROM your_table;

解释如下:

  • your_array - 数组名称。
  • 1 - 数组维度,通常为 1。
  • array_length() - 返回数组的长度。
  • array[] - 用于访问特定索引处的数组元素。
  • AS last_element - 将查询结果重命名为 last_element

因此,上面的查询将返回数组的最后一个元素。

然而,请注意,如果数组为空,则此查询将返回 NULL。

希望这个简短的介绍对于 PostgreSQL 开发人员有所帮助。